Near equilibrium unbinding of streptavidin/biotin using single molecule acoustic force spectroscopy
The dissociation of the streptavidin-biotin (SA-b) bond has been widely characterized using bulk and single molecule force spectroscopy (SMFS) techniques. However, the dissociation rates ( k off) from...
